Just received my pair of AT HDry but side of the left insole curves upward instead of properly sitting in the shoe so it is uncomfortable to wear as it rubs against the side of my foot. Since all I need is for the one defective insole to be replaced, I had thrown the box away and removed the tags as I plan on wearing them after getting the insole replaced. Apparently Tropicfeel cannot just send a replacement insole. They suggested that I either buy insoles myself from a shoe store or to pay €8 for the cost of the return to exchange the whole pair (which I cannot do now without the original packaging). Why would you expect your customer to pay out-of-pocket to come up with a solution for sending them something defective?!
Even though I was really annoyed with the above, I have to say once I got my own insoles, they are really comfortable to wear and lightweight when travelling. I wore them in the city with cobblestone when it's raining and on the beach and my feet stayed dry.

I bought the collapsible wardrobe for a camping safari later this year. It’s like having 3 decent sized packing cubes but the beauty is that the strapping condenses it to about 2/3 of the original size leaving plenty of room in my hold-all for shoe’s and toiletries. On arrival, I can simply hang it up in the tent like a mini wardrobe and no more rummaging around for the right packing cubes.
